Carbon Filter Installation in Houston, TX
Carbon filter installation services involve setting up specialized filtration systems designed to remove odors, chemicals, and airborne contaminants from indoor air. These systems are commonly used in residential properties such as kitchens, basements, or areas with strong odors, as well as in HVAC systems to improve overall air quality. Property owners often seek this service when they want to eliminate persistent smells, improve indoor air freshness, or address concerns related to airborne pollutants. Before requesting installation, it’s helpful to understand the size and layout of the space, the specific odors or contaminants to be addressed, and the type of existing ventilation or air handling systems in place.
Homeowners considering carbon filter installation typically want to know about the compatibility of the system with their current setup, the expected effectiveness, and maintenance requirements. It’s also useful to clarify whether the installation will involve ductwork modifications or integration with existing HVAC units. Understanding these details can help ensure the chosen filtration solution meets the specific needs of the property and provides long-lasting air quality improvements.

Carbon Filter Installation Questions
What is a carbon filter used for? A carbon filter helps remove odors, chemicals, and pollutants from indoor air or water systems, improving overall quality.
Where can carbon filter installation be beneficial? It is useful in homes with strong odors, chemical sensitivities, or water treatment needs to ensure cleaner air and water.
How often should a carbon filter be replaced? Replacement frequency depends on usage, but generally, filters should be changed every 6 to 12 months for optimal performance.
What types of projects typically require carbon filter installation? Projects include air purification systems, water filtration setups, and HVAC upgrades to enhance indoor air and water quality.
